I have noticed that the 3 D6 dice I have printed all has the same deformity. I chose to make the D6 16mm, I then choose to have the fin supports generated and use the default orientation. This orientation places a corner of the dice that is common to the 3, 5 and 6 faces at the bottom. I then chose to use a lighter contact width, 0.15 mm. I then chose to also use a thinner connection width, 0.25mm. I did this hoping to make removing the supports easier and cleanup easier. 

What I end up with is a slight deformity with that corner, like it was slightly stretched, less than a mm. But, the really weird thing to me is that all 3 of D6s I printed have the same deformity at the same location and dimensions.

I am using an ANYCUBIC MONO 4K, with their basic resin and an exposure time of 6s. 


Has anyone else seen this problem?


I am going to go back and try using the default values for the fin supports as well.


thanks.

Hi there, fellow dice maker here! the D6 is notorious for being difficult to print. make sure to dial in your exposure settings, 6s is pretty high for  the mono 4k. I run siraya tech fast at about 2.2-2.8 seconds.
